The iPhone 17 Pro Max is expected to launch in September 2025, consistent with Apple’s historical release patterns for new iPhone models. This aligns with reports from reputable sources like MacRumors’ iPhone 17 Roundup and PhoneArena’s iPhone 17 Pro Max Release, which suggest a September rollout. The lineup will include four models: the iPhone 17, iPhone 17 Pro, iPhone 17 Pro Max, and the newly introduced iPhone 17 Air. The iPhone 17 Air is rumored to be an ultra-thin device, potentially 6mm thick with a 6.6-inch display, replacing the less popular Plus model, as noted in Tom’s Guide iPhone 17 Air vs Pro Max.
The iPhone 17 Pro Max is anticipated to feature a hybrid design, combining glass and aluminum for increased durability, as per the Forbes iPhone 17 Pro Design Leak. This build is expected to support wireless charging while reducing breakage risks, with a potential thickness of 8.725mm to accommodate a larger battery, up from the iPhone 16 Pro Max’s 8.25mm. Design leaks also suggest a horizontal or elongated oval camera bump, a departure from the square design, which could enhance aesthetics and functionality, as detailed in MacRumors’ iPhone 17 Pro Camera Design.
The display is expected to remain at 6.9 inches, featuring 120Hz ProMotion, now extended to non-Pro models, ensuring smoother interactions. Reports indicate an anti-reflective, “super hard” coating for increased scratch resistance, as mentioned in MacRumors’ iPhone 17 Pro Roundup. This upgrade aims to improve visibility and durability, catering to users who prioritize display quality.
Performance-wise, the iPhone 17 Pro Max is rumored to be powered by the A19 Pro chip, utilizing an upgraded N3P 3-nanometer process for enhanced efficiency and speed, as per the MacRumors iPhone 17 Pro 12GB RAM Rumor. It will likely feature 12GB RAM, up from 8GB in previous Pro models, supporting better multitasking. Thermal management is expected to improve with vapor chamber cooling, detailed in MacRumors’ iPhone 17 Pro Advanced Cooling, ensuring sustained performance during heavy usage.
The camera system is set for a major overhaul, with a 24MP front-facing camera, up from 12MP, enhancing selfie and video call quality, as noted in MacRumors’ iPhone 17 24MP Front Camera. The rear setup will include three 48MP lenses: Wide, Ultra Wide, and Telephoto, with the Telephoto lens upgraded from 12MP to offer 3.5x optical zoom, supporting simulated 5x zoom, as per MacRumors iPhone 17 Pro 48MP Telephoto. Rumors also suggest a mechanical aperture for the Wide camera to adjust depth of field and potential 8K video recording, pushing mobile videography limits, as detailed in MacRumors’ iPhone 17 Pro Supports 8K Video. A new dual video recording feature, allowing simultaneous front and rear camera use, is also anticipated, ideal for content creators, as per MacRumors’ iPhone 17 Pro Dual Video Recording.

Battery life is expected to improve with a larger capacity, facilitated by the thicker design, and a new adhesive for easier battery replacement, similar to the iPhone 16, as noted in MacRumors’ iPhone 17 Pro Dummies Highlight Design. Charging speeds are rumored to reach 35W wired across the lineup, up from the iPhone 16 Pro’s sustained 30W, as per MacRumors’ iPhone 17 Lineup 35W Charging. Reverse wireless charging is expected to increase to 7.5W, up from 4.5W, enhancing accessory charging capabilities, as detailed in MacRumors’ iPhone 17 Pro Reverse Charging Feature.

Connectivity upgrades include a Qualcomm 5G modem for the iPhone 17 Pro Max, while the iPhone 17 Air may use Apple’s custom modem, as per the MacRumors iPhone 17 Air Wi-Fi 7 Rumor. It will feature Apple’s custom Wi-Fi 7 chip, supporting 2.4GHz, 5GHz, and 6GHz bands with peak speeds over 40Gb/s, improving efficiency, as noted in MacRumors’ Kuo’s iPhone 17 Models Wi-Fi 7 Chip. Bluetooth 5.3 is expected for enhanced accessory compatibility.
Regarding charging, the iPhone 17 Pro Max will continue to support USB-C, as confirmed by EU regulations, with no port less design for this model, as per 9to5Mac EU Confirms Port less iPhone. However, the redesigned camera bump may affect compatibility with bulkier MagSafe chargers, potentially necessitating slimmer options, as mentioned in T3’s iPhone 17 Pro MagSafe Compatibility.
The iPhone 17 Air is positioned as a thinner, more affordable option compared to the iPhone 17 Pro Max, with a rumored thickness of 5.5-6mm and a single rear camera in a pill-shaped bar, as per Tom’s Guide iPhone 17 Air vs Pro Max. This contrasts with the iPhone 17 Pro Max‘s flagship features, making it a top choice for power users, while the iPhone 17 Air targets those seeking portability.
